On the 28th, Gravity and Chungnam Information Culture Industry Promotion Agency (Chungnam Global Game Center) announced that they had signed a business agreement for game production and global advancement by game developers located in South Chungcheong Province.

Through this agreement, Gravity and the Chungnam Global Game Center agreed to establish a continuous cooperative relationship and an organic work cooperation system, and to support the global advancement and growth of game companies in Chungnam.

In particular, Gravity plans to support game development of game companies in the Chungnam region for its representative IP ‘Ragnarok’, and at the same time, actively support game companies in the Chungnam region by utilizing its know-how in servicing various games.

In addition, we plan to cooperate with the Chungnam Information Culture Industry Promotion Agency to discover competitive game companies in the global market by leading ESG management activities, creating social values in the Chungnam region, and promoting win-win cooperation with small and medium-sized game companies.
